We definitely got outcoached in this game just like vs. the Giants. Did anyone notice how the Jags secondary was terribly outta position on the early Collie TD's; TIME TO GET RID OF THE ZONE DEFENSE!!! Manning was making Swiss cheese of that zone defense. Notice how much better the Jags secondary played later in the game when they switched to man defense. Rashean haters can't blame him for this lost; He played well, and Considine looks like he should get demoted to the UFL.

I'm no offensive coordinator by no means, but if you happen to go for it on 4th down in your own end (dumb decision BTW) Why not run a QB sneak with a powerful running QB, instead of running a RB Toss which allows Indy's elusive, fast lateral speed LB's (like Brackett) to make the tackle on MJD? Everybody knows the best way to run at Indy is straight forward!

Over aggression is a weakness, and we were exposed!!!Last play of the third quarter, I'm screaming RUN MOJO!!!, No, Garrard throws a crucial pick; That reminded me of the NYG game 4th quarter before the 2:00 warning, I'm again screaming RUN MOJO!!!, and Garrard stepped back to pass and took a big loss on a sack.
